### Receipt Dispatch Endpoint

The Givenlight donation-receipt mailer exposes a single POST endpoint that queues a formatted receipt for delivery. Requests must include the donation record identifier and a template version; malformed payloads are rejected with a descriptive error rather than silently dropped. All calls are authenticated against the internal Candlewick auth service, and the key you should use during onboarding appears directly below.

service key, fawip-bajef: kto11_Qt5wZK9vdNC

Minutes — Gross-Margin Review, Tallowick Group

Sales leads reviewed Q3 margins by segment. Hardware margin slipped to 31% on freight costs; services held at 58%. Mr. Drannet recommended repricing the Vexley bundle and tightening discount approvals. Actions were assigned with two-week deadlines. The confidential planning note follows below.

internal memo for kawip-hadug: Headcount on the Wenwyn team goes from 7 to 140 by the end of January. Gross margin on Wenwyn came in at 20 percent against a plan of 15 percent.

## Support

We are midway through migrating the legacy cron jobs into the Wrenflow workflow engine. Before editing any schedule, check whether it has already been ported; duplicates have bitten us twice. The migration tracker in the Tallgrove wiki lists ownership per job. For questions about unported jobs, write to the platform crew.

escalation mailbox, kagep-fajop: pelox.briath.goriel@zemvarcloud.corp